3 Gallon Reconditioned Corny Keg
Price: $74.95
For a Limited Time - While Supplies Last - These are about the cutest little kegs we've ever seen!!!! Get one while you can at a great price. Approximate dimensions: 17" tall, 8.5" in diameter.
